What Color Is Orchid

What Color Is Orchid. Orchid is a shade of purple with a generous splash of pink. Phalaenopsis, or moth orchids, come in a myriad of colors, displaying exotics patterns and intricate designs.

Orchid takes its name from the orchid flower,. Orchid is a shade of purple with a generous splash of pink. Orchid is a bright rich purple color that resembles the color of some orchids.

As A Purple Hue, Orchid Is Quite Similar To The Color Of Orchid Flowers.


Orchid is a rich, vivid purple color with the hex code #da70d6, the first of a series of pink and purple shades using “orchid” in their names.
